Top 10 Dart Frameworks for Web Development

Are you looking for a powerful and efficient way to develop web applications using the Dart programming language? Look no further than these top 10 Dart frameworks for web development! With their intuitive interfaces, robust features, and flexible customization options, these frameworks are sure to help you create stunning web applications that will impress your clients and users alike.

1. AngularDart

AngularDart is a popular framework for building web applications using the Dart programming language. It provides a comprehensive set of tools and features for creating dynamic and responsive web applications, including data binding, dependency injection, and component-based architecture. With AngularDart, you can easily create complex web applications that are easy to maintain and scale.

2. Aqueduct

Aqueduct is a powerful and flexible framework for building server-side web applications using the Dart programming language. It provides a robust set of features for creating RESTful APIs, including authentication, authorization, and database integration. With Aqueduct, you can easily create scalable and secure web applications that can handle high traffic loads.

3. Angel

Angel is a lightweight and flexible framework for building web applications using the Dart programming language. It provides a simple and intuitive interface for creating RESTful APIs, as well as support for websockets and server-side rendering. With Angel, you can easily create fast and responsive web applications that are easy to deploy and maintain.

4. Redstone

Redstone is a powerful and flexible framework for building web applications using the Dart programming language. It provides a comprehensive set of tools and features for creating RESTful APIs, including support for authentication, authorization, and database integration. With Redstone, you can easily create scalable and secure web applications that can handle high traffic loads.

5. Shelf

Shelf is a lightweight and flexible framework for building web applications using the Dart programming language. It provides a simple and intuitive interface for creating HTTP servers, as well as support for middleware and static file serving. With Shelf, you can easily create fast and responsive web applications that are easy to deploy and maintain.

6. Polymer

Polymer is a popular framework for building web components using the Dart programming language. It provides a comprehensive set of tools and features for creating reusable and customizable web components, including data binding, event handling, and component-based architecture. With Polymer, you can easily create complex web applications that are easy to maintain and scale.

7. OverReact

OverReact is a powerful and flexible framework for building web applications using the Dart programming language. It provides a comprehensive set of tools and features for creating reusable and customizable web components, including support for data binding, event handling, and component-based architecture. With OverReact, you can easily create complex web applications that are easy to maintain and scale.

8. StageXL

StageXL is a powerful and flexible framework for building web games using the Dart programming language. It provides a comprehensive set of tools and features for creating 2D and 3D games, including support for graphics, animation, and physics. With StageXL, you can easily create stunning web games that are fun and engaging for users.

9. Dart Web Components

Dart Web Components is a popular framework for building web components using the Dart programming language. It provides a comprehensive set of tools and features for creating reusable and customizable web components, including support for data binding, event handling, and component-based architecture. With Dart Web Components, you can easily create complex web applications that are easy to maintain and scale.

10. Dart Server Pages

Dart Server Pages is a powerful and flexible framework for building server-side web applications using the Dart programming language. It provides a comprehensive set of tools and features for creating dynamic and responsive web applications, including support for templates, database integration, and authentication. With Dart Server Pages, you can easily create scalable and secure web applications that can handle high traffic loads.

In conclusion, these top 10 Dart frameworks for web development are sure to help you create stunning web applications that will impress your clients and users alike. Whether you're building RESTful APIs, web components, or web games, these frameworks provide the tools and features you need to create fast, responsive, and scalable web applications. So why wait? Start exploring these frameworks today and see what they can do for your web development projects!

Additional Resources

techdeals.dev - A technology, games, computers and software deals, similar to slickdeals
multicloud.tips - multi cloud cloud deployment and management
localcommunity.dev - local community meetups, groups, and online get togethers
cicd.video - continuous integration continuous delivery
opsbook.dev - cloud operations and deployment
buildquiz.com - A site for making quizzes and flashcards to study and learn. knowledge management.
communitywiki.dev - A community driven wiki about software engineering
cloudchecklist.dev - A site for cloud readiness and preparedness, similar to Amazon well architected
learnaws.dev - learning AWS
jupyter.app - cloud notebooks using jupyter, best practices, python data science and machine learning
bestonlinecourses.app - free online higher education, university, college, courses like the open courseware movement
ocaml.tips - ocaml tips
secretsmanagement.dev - secrets management in the cloud
devsecops.review - A site reviewing different devops features
enterpriseready.dev - enterprise ready tooling, large scale infrastructure
nftassets.dev - crypto nft assets you can buy
learnmachinelearning.dev - learning machine learning
learntypescript.app - learning typescript
neo4j.app - neo4j software engineering
startupvalue.app - assessing the value of a startup


Written by AI researcher, Haskell Ruska, PhD (haskellr@mit.edu). Scientific Journal of AI 2023, Peer Reviewed